                    Maryland Dorchester County Sc.   Be it remembered and
it is hereby Certified that on this second day of August Eighteen hundred
and forty seven personally appeared the above named James Frazier of
Levin before the subscriber a Justice of the Peace for the County and
State aforesaid and Acknowledged the above and foregoing Bill of sale
to be his Act and deed and delivered the same for the uses and
purposes therein mentioned according to the Acts of Assembly in such
cases made and provided               Acknowledged before
                                                                                  Robert Bell J. P.


Ann Corbin             Be it remembered that the following Bill of
       from    Ex.d      Sale was recorded the 4.th day of August 1847.
W.m S. Corbin        {Stamp}   Know all men by these presents that I
                              {one dol.}  William S. Corbin have agreed to execute
these presents, To wit:  Whereas for the purpose of satisfying the claims
of my Creditors my Wife Ann M. Corbin did together with myself
execute a Mortgage upon certain lands in Dorchester County belonging
to my said Wife in her own right to a certain James A. Stewart
who did make the advances to my creditors and the said Mortgage
was given to him  And Whereas I have in my own right certain
personal property which in justice and equity ought to be secured
to my wife from all casualties of trade owing to her having agreed
to execute the said Mortgage   Now therefore in consideration of
the premises and of one dollar to me in hand paid by M.s Ann
Corbin my Mother I have bargained & sold to the said Ann Corbin
all of my said personal property of every description consisting of the
following Articles, To wit:  two Cows, 1 yoke of Oxen, ten Sheep, 4 Beds,
1 high post Bedstead, 3 low Bedsteads, 1 English Carpet, Sofa, Settee,
